Fort Buford State Historic Site
Williston, ND

Commanding a historic northern plains crossroads, Fort Buford State Historic Site offers history, beauty, and recreation. At the site a museum in an original military building tells the fort's story; a nearby military cemetery and a stone powder magazine emphasize the fort's history, enhanced by interpretive exhibits.

The confluence area adds a wealth of attractions. The Fort Buford site includes a picnic area, campground, and every spring a large paddle-fishing operation attracts hundreds of sportsmen. In July of every year the 6th Infantry reenactment group holds its annual Fort Buford Sixth Infantry Frontier Military Encampment. A few miles away, Fort Union Trading Post National Historic Site interprets the fur trade that made the confluence a nineteenth-century crossroads and a historic, exciting place to be! Fort Buford is located just off Highway 23 about twenty-five miles southwest of Williston, Williams County.

There is an admission fee of $5.00 per adult and $2.50 per child. Admission fee includes admission to Missouri-Yellowstone Confluence Interpretive Center.
